Charlie Kirk: A Full Biography and the Context of His Assassination
The entire controversy hinges on the tragic and shocking event of Charlie Kirk’s death. Kirk was a prominent and often polarizing figure on the American right, known for his relentless efforts to mobilize young conservative voters. His assassination created a political vacuum and immediately became a flashpoint for national outrage and political maneuvering, which Kimmel's comments later addressed.
Charlie Kirk's Biographical Profile
- Full Name: Charles James Kirk
- Date of Birth: October 14, 1993
- Date of Death: September 10, 2025
- Cause of Death: Assassination (shot by a gunman)
- Location of Assassination: While addressing an audience on the campus of Utah Valley University
- Primary Role: American right-wing political activist, entrepreneur, and media personality.
- Key Organization: Founder and CEO (President) of Turning Point USA (TPUSA).
- TPUSA Mission: To identify, educate, train, and organize students to promote the principles of freedom, free markets, and limited government.
- Political Affiliation: Strongly associated with the conservative and MAGA movements.
Kirk was shot and killed by a 22-year-old suspect during an outdoor event at Utah Valley University on September 10, 2025. The murder immediately sparked national outrage, with federal investigators becoming involved and the suspect being charged with capital murder.
The Monologue That Shook Late-Night: Kimmel's Controversial Remarks
The firestorm began when Jimmy Kimmel addressed the assassination in his opening monologue on Jimmy Kimmel Live!. Kimmel, a vocal critic of former President Donald Trump and the MAGA movement, used the segment not to mourn Kirk directly, but to criticize the political response to his death.
Kimmel's core argument was that the MAGA movement and allies of President Trump were "desperately trying to characterize this kid who murdered Charlie Kirk as anything other than one of them" and were attempting to "politically capitalize on the murder of Charlie Kirk." This framing—suggesting that the right was exploiting the tragedy for political gain and trying to distance themselves from the shooter—was the flashpoint.
The host also specifically condemned President Trump's way of "mourning" Kirk, suggesting that the president did not attempt to bring the country together but instead used the tragedy to further political division. The perception that Kimmel was making light of the tragedy or, worse, weaponizing it against his political rivals immediately ignited a massive backlash across conservative media and social platforms.
The Fallout: ABC Suspension, Public Outcry, and the Freedom of Speech Debate
The reaction to Kimmel's monologue was swift and severe. Within days, ABC made the unprecedented decision to pull Jimmy Kimmel Live! off the air "indefinitely." The network's statement indicated that the company "strongly objects to recent comments made by Mr. Kimmel concerning the killing of Charlie Kirk" and would replace the show with other programming.
The suspension fueled a massive public outcry, with hashtags like #JimmyKimmelFired trending worldwide. The controversy quickly transcended a simple media spat, becoming a national debate on several critical issues:
- Corporate Censorship: Many critics, including some on the left, viewed the ABC suspension as a form of corporate censorship, arguing that a major network was silencing a host for political speech.
- Political Polarization: The event underscored the deep political chasm in America, where a late-night host's commentary on a tragedy could lead to a network pulling his show.
- The Line of Decency: Conservative figures argued that Kimmel had crossed a line of decency by using a murder to score political points, regardless of his intent.
- The MAGA Response: The controversy was immediately seized upon by conservative commentators and political figures, including Donald Trump, who celebrated the suspension, framing it as a victory against the "fake news" media.
The indefinite nature of the suspension—a rare move for a network's flagship late-night program—sent a clear message about the perceived severity of Kimmel's comments and the pressure ABC faced from conservative groups and affiliates like Sinclair Broadcast Group.
The Tearful Return: Kimmel's Clarification and the Mischaracterization Claim
After a period of absence, Jimmy Kimmel returned to the air, addressing the controversy directly in a highly emotional monologue. In a significant shift from his usual comedic tone, Kimmel held back tears and maintained that his original remarks had been "intentionally and maliciously mischaracterized" by conservatives.
Kimmel's defense was that his comments were not intended to mock Charlie Kirk’s death or the tragedy itself, but rather to critique the political opportunism he saw in the aftermath. He stated unequivocally that the assassination was "not funny."
The host accused those who pushed the narrative that he was celebrating the murder of seeking to silence him and other critics of the MAGA movement. This return monologue served as both an apology for the misunderstanding and a doubling-down on his right to criticize the political reaction, marking a poignant moment in the history of late-night political commentary.
